概述

This course provides an in-depth exploration of sequential decision making and its industrial applications. Students will gain a solid foundation in stochastic modeling, Markov Decision Processes (MDPs), and Reinforcement Learning (RL), with a focus on practical applications in optimization, automation, and decision-making under uncertainty. Hands-on experience through project work and presentations will ensure students can apply these concepts to real-world industrial problems.

先修科目

Basic probability theory, operations research

教學方式

Python-language programming

評分方式

•Homework Assignments: 10% •Midterm Exam: 30% •Project: 30% •Final Exam: 30%

週次計畫
週次主題
第 1 週Introduction to Sequential Decision Making and Analytics
第 2 週Stochastic Modeling: Basic Probability, Conditional Probabilities
第 3 週Stochastic Modeling: Markov Chain Properties
第 4 週MDP: Overview of MDP
第 5 週MDP: Policy and Value Functions
第 6 週MDP: Bellman Equations
第 7 週MDP: Finite-Horizon and Infinite-Horizon MDPs
第 8 週MDP: Policy and Value Iteration Methods
第 9 週Midterm Exam
第 10 週RL: Introduction to Reinforcement Learning
第 11 週RL: Q-Learning and SARSA
第 12 週RL: Temporal Difference (TD) Learning
第 13 週Multi-Armed Bandits: Basics and Exploration Strategies
第 14 週Multi-Armed Bandits: Advanced Topics and Thompson sampling
第 15 週Final Exam
第 16 週Project Presentation
教科書

• Ross, Sheldon M. (2014) Introduction to probability models. Academic press. (optional) • Puterman, M. L. (2014). Markov decision processes: discrete stochastic dynamic programming. John Wiley & Sons. (optional) • Sutton R. & Barto A. (2020). Reinforcement Learning: An Introduction (2nd Edition). Cambridge: The MIT Press. (free online)
